What is A Soft Murmur?
A Soft Murmur is an ambient sound-mixing app for productivity and sleep, available on iOS and Android.
Users hire the app to create custom, non-repeating audio environments that mask distractions without the privacy or data-usage costs of ad-supported alternatives.

What Are The Key Features?
Randomized volume modulation for active sounds to simulate natural, non-repeating environmental audio
Audio engine designed for continuous, loop-based playback without audible clicks or gaps
Ten-track soundboard with six sounds locked behind a single in-app purchase
How much does it cost?
- Free tier with 4 base sounds
- Single in-app purchase to unlock 6 additional sounds
Monetization relies on a one-time purchase model to unlock the full sound library rather than recurring subscriptions.

The outtake for A Soft Murmur
Strengths to defend, gaps to attack
Core Strengths
- Privacy-focused offline architecture eliminates data-tracking friction
- Granular mixing engine enables unique, non-repetitive soundscapes
Critical Frictions
- 0.7★ Android-iOS rating gap indicates platform-specific stability issues
- Lack of cloud-sync for purchases causes support-ticket churn
Growth Levers
- B2B partnerships for workplace wellness programs
- Expansion into specialized noise profiles like brown or green noise
Market Threats
- Subscription-based competitors with higher content-refresh cadences
- Technical instability on Android causing negative review spikes
What are the next best moves?
Stabilize Android audio engine because playback stuttering is the #1 complaint → reduce churn
Android rating is significantly lower than iOS due to playback stability issues.
Trade-off: Pause new sound library expansion until playback stability reaches 99% uptime.
Implement cloud-based purchase restoration because account-sync failures drive support volume → improve sentiment
Multiple reviews cite inability to restore Pro status after device changes.
Trade-off: Deprioritize the requested toddler-safe mode until account infrastructure is reliable.
